技术分享 linux mysql导出sql文件

jacques · 2023-11-19 18:20:02 · 热度: 20

Linux下使用 MySQL 导出 SQL 文件

在应用程序与数据库打交道的时候,我们时常需要备份或者迁移数据库。把数据库备份成SQL文件是最常见的一种方式,这篇文章将会详细讲解如何在 Linux 系统下使用MySQL导出SQL文件。

安装MySQL

在使用MySQL导出SQL文件之前,我们需要先安装MySQL服务。下面是安装步骤:

1. 首先更新apt-get软件源,运行以下命令:

sudo apt-get update

2. 接下来,运行以下命令安装MySQL服务:

sudo apt-get install mysql-server

3. 安装完成后,我们需要为MySQL设置安全性选项,以防止未经授权的访问。运行以下命令:

sudo mysql_secure_installation

按照提示输入密码、增加管理员账户、删除测试用户等操作,最终将对MySQL进行一次综合的安全设置。

导出SQL文件

在安装配置MySQL完成后,我们想要导出SQL文件,可以简单地运行以下命令:

mysqldump -u 用户名 -p 数据库名 > 导出的文件名.sql

其中,用户名是MySQL登录时的用户名,数据库名是要备份的数据库名,导出的文件名可以自由指定。

如果你想备份整个MySQL服务器上的所有数据库,可以指定--all-databases选项,命令如下:

mysqldump -u 用户名 -p --all-databases > 导出的文件名.sql

指定备份数据表

从整个MySQL服务器备份所有数据库的SQL文件中,很容易找到特定表的备份。但是如果只需要备份某个特定的表,可以简单地在mysqldump命令中指定表的名称:

mysqldump -u 用户名 -p 数据库名 数据表名 > 导出的文件名.sql

结语

Linux下使用MySQL导出SQL文件非常简单,只需要几个命令就可以完成。通过备份SQL文件,可以在服务器迁移、版本升级或有意识地进行版本回滚时快速还原数据库。如果你以后需要恢复数据库时,只需要运行以下命令:

mysql -u 用户名 -p 数据库名

不管你是初学者还是经验丰富的开发者,备份和恢复数据库都是必不可少的技能。本文所述就是一种简单易行的备份方法,妥善保存SQL文件,将大有裨益。

猜你喜欢:
暂无回复。
需要 登录 后方可回复, 如果你还没有账号请点击这里 注册